The global dishwasher market is anticipated to reach USD 17.5 Billion by 2031 at a CAGR of 7.9%. The main drivers of the global dishwasher market are changing lifestyle and urbanisation, which has heavily impacted the importance of time saving, and ease of convenience. Moreover, the key trends such as the rising smart home technology, wherein dishwashers take advantage of IoT features in order to operate and monitor remotely has brought new opportunities for the market growth in the upcoming years.
The major factors that drive the growth of the global dishwasher market are the rapid urbanisation, rising disposable income, and rising awareness of water and energy conservation. As the pace of modern lives is becoming busier, the demand for more convenience in household chores is increasing. The comfort and efficiency provided by the dishwasher is mostly what attracts consumers when they attain affluency. Most urban dwellers have little time and space; however, the more people need to rush, the increased adoption rate of modern appliance adoption, such as the dishwashing machine, to solve the rapidity and the efficiency of everyday solutions. The continuous innovation in the dishwasher technology enhances functionality & efficiency, and is another major factor driving the global dishwasher market. Some smart features such as app connectivity and sensor-based washing cycles make them appealing to the tech-savvy consumer. Similarly, better energy and water conservation ability makes the new models of dishwashers more attractive; helping consumers save on utility bills while reducing environmental degradation.
The rise of e-commerce has completely altered the way most shoppers procure appliances. The competitive prices and increased portfolios offered at these e-commerce platforms have made it easier for consumers to purchase dishwashers. The buyers are given an opportunity to compare different models and read reviews from previous users to make informed purchasing decisions, which fuels the growth of the global dishwasher market as well.
Most countries have established energy standards whereby household appliances such as a dishwasher are energy efficiency rated. For example, the U.S has its ENERGY STAR program, while similarly leading projects abound within the EU, which compels the manufacturers to design models that will consume minimal amounts of water and energy. Waste management and recycling-related regulations also motivate the industry to practise sustainable development by encouraging manufacturers to improve their products in a green manner. This encourages innovation in the dishwashing market, where companies are forced to produce some of the most advanced, efficient products in line with governmental sustainability goals.

Impact of Covid-19
With COVID-19 pandemic, the market witnessed a rise in hygiene awareness globally. The growing concerns over cleanliness and hygiene made many consumers prefer dishwashing machines as more effective in killing off germs and bacteria than hand washing. Thus, dishwashers became an increased attraction as consumers sought a way of ensuring that their kitchenware was clean. The lockdowns also popularised home cooking, which then raised the demand for dishwashers as well. With restaurants closed down and people locked themselves inside their homes with a little else to do but cook as a way of controlling their meals. Therefore, dirty dishes increased, and households realised the ease of using dishwashers. Thus, the factors above led to a mushrooming effect in sales for dishwashers. The manufacturers adopted these trends and devised promotions on the virtues of using a dishwasher to further increase market growth.
However, some of the main issues due to the COVID-19 pandemic involved supply chain restrictions on account of manufacturing delays, transportation restrictions, and shortages of elements necessary for production and distribution of dishwashers. This made them less accessible and resulted in delivery periods that took an even longer time, frustrating consumers and dropping sales. Moreover, the uncertainty and the loss of jobs following this crisis forced most of the households to spend primarily on necessary expenditures instead of buying appliances like dishwashers. The consumers in that period of time had become much more cautious of their spending, and they would not spend on discretionary items. This altogether changed the buyers' preference and thereby hurt the growth of the market for this particular product, dishwashers. All these factors put together posed the challenge for the manufacturers and the retailers alike to adjust fast to the changing patterns of the behaviour of consumers following the pandemic.
Segmentation
The global dishwasher market is segmented into product type, application, and distribution channel. By product type, the market is segmented into built-in dishwasher, freestanding dishwasher, and others. The freestanding dishwashers held the largest share in the global dishwasher market. These are not installed dishwashers, hence many opt for them. They come in various sizes, styles, and price ranges, and are relatively sold at a lower price compared to the built-in types. This makes it easier for most consumers to purchase them owing to their easy installation and portability. The freestanding dishwashers can easily be transferred and moved as they are also flexible with their kitchen layouts. The built-in dishwashers are designed to be installed permanently with kitchen cabinetry in order to provide a fluid flow with an integrated look.
The built-in dishwashers are expected to have the highest growth rate in the forecast period due to the improvements in design, efficiency, and convenience. The built-in dishwashers appear clean and hygienic as they immediately connect to the plumbing and electrical components of the house. Models of this type are complex in several ways, including several cycles of wash, energy-saving settings and smart connectivity that enable them to control the operation remotely using smartphones. The integration into countertops is extremely in demand by homeowners who want aesthetic appeal along with greater functionality in the design of their kitchen.
By application, the market is segmented into residential, and commercial. The commercial segment holds the largest market share in the global dishwasher market. Commercial refers to the dishwashers installed in commercial places such as restaurants, hotels, and catering services. The commercial dishwashers are built for durability and speed and are often offered as high-capacity pieces which can accept a lot of load and high usage. Moreover, this appliance's attraction is in the technological advancements, especially energy-saving appliances and faster wash cycles. The hospitality industry is surely recovering from the pandemic impact; therefore, hygiene and sanitization are of prime concern.
The residential/household segment is expected to have the highest growth rate during the forecast period due to the upward trend in incomes and increased focus on convenience at home. The residential or household application of the dishwasher market includes all those appliances used at home. The particular segment of family and individual needs have been catered to by this growing demand for convenience and efficiency in routine chores due to busy lifestyles, which subsequently leaves the consumers seeking appliances that save them time.
By distribution channel, the market is segmented into offline, and online. The offline segment holds the largest market share in the global dishwasher market largely due to the fortification of brick-and-mortar retail wherein consumers can come, see, and compare before buying. The offline distribution channel is the traditional retail scenario that consists of appliance stores, hypermarkets and specialty retailers. The customers generally prefer to avail direct access to sales personnel for consulting assistance, personal counselling, and in-shop offers. The availability around the corner and home delivery have greatly added to the appeal of shopping through offline media. The trend is ongoing in the offline segment, mainly in geographies where consumers are in need of touch and feeling before purchasing and are not inclined to place large appliance orders online.
However, the online segment is expected to have the highest growth rate during the forecast period. The online distribution channel has built up so much momentum with the good push from e-commerce and comfort associated with it. The increasing numbers of consumers are now researching and comparing prices online before they finally purchase a dishwasher. This channel provides more options and sometimes competitive prices, hence appealing to price-conscious customers. Other advantages of online shopping are that technology can further be developed in such areas as augmented reality tools, making it possible to demonstrate products virtually. In addition, aided by the vastly increasing online segment, more consumers appreciate ease and the opportunity to shop from home.
Regional Analysis
North America holds the largest market share in the global dishwasher market owing to the high disposable incomes in the region, which are then spent in investing in highly sophisticated kitchen appliances of which an energy-efficient and smart dishwasher is a prime necessity. The convenience and efficiency in doing household chores are now growing in popularity, thus encouraging more dishwashers that are built-in with sleek integration in modern kitchen layouts. The major retail and online platforms also give immense access to the market whereby the consumers can easily compare the features and prices of their desired dishwashers. The efforts made by regulatory bodies in energy efficiency are not in isolation with technological advances that have enticed manufacturers to make models that respect good environmental standards. Therefore, it receives a high demand for technologically advanced and high-quality dishwashers in the North American market.
Europe has significant market share in the global dishwasher market, with Germany, France, and the UK being some of the most notable contributors. The consumer preference for energy efficiency as well as ecologically friendly appliances especially in Europe drives the demand for built-in dishwashers. These are particularly in high demand from Germany due to its focus on high-quality engineering and sustainability, leading to a need to reduce water and energy usage. France and the UK also have a high propensity towards smart home technologies, where the majority of the units are connected, providing customers with extra control. The regulatory environment in Europe further encourages energy-efficient appliances, and this enhances consumer appeal. As the market matures, European manufacturers innovate in terms of design and functionality, and sustainability focus as well.
The Asia Pacific region is expected to have the highest growth rate in the global dishwasher market during the forecast period. China, India, and Japan are the countries that drive the growth of this market in the Asia Pacific region. The rapid urbanisation and growth of middle-class families using modern appliances are some of the driving factors for the market growth in the region. In China, it's a shift in consumer lifestyle with growing disposable incomes. Mostly younger families looking for convenience are changing the way people view acceptance of dishwashers. In India, too, there is improvement in acceptance of this product, and more attempts in offering more economical versions that suit budget and preferences of the local market. In August 2024, Robert Bosch’s subsidiary BSH launched a new range of Bosch and Siemens dishwashers in India. These dishwashers are designed by keeping Indian families in mind and can boast a 15-place setting capacity. Similarly, in July 2024, Elista launched three dishwashers in India. These dishwashers are made to clean sticky and ghee-laden utensils without leaving any residue. In Japan, known for technological innovation, compact design that consumes less energy is the choice for the urban little living spaces. The Asia-Pacific region is expected to experience a high growth rate due to increasing awareness of the merits of dishwashers accompanied by the strengthened infrastructure in the retail sector.
Latin America has low to medium market share and prevails in the global dishwasher market. The economic inequality and conservative orientations towards modes of washing affect the entire adoption process as most have still primarily remained dependent on hand washing. However, the rapid urbanization and growth of a new middle-class segment are increasingly propelling consumers to opt for modern appliances. The developing middle-class market in Brazil is only beginning to acquire the trend of kitchen automation, while dishwashers are becoming easier to retail due to the expansion.
The Middle East and Africa represent the lowest market share in the global dishwasher market. Beside economic constraints, cultural practices and priorities concerning consumer interests provide for slower adaptation levels. Several countries include South Africa and the UAE, which express at least some interest in modern kitchen appliances; however, their penetration levels are low as a whole. Urban regions further up their concern over kitchen automation, while most households rely on traditional washing. However, with improved economies, the infrastructures for retail are getting better, and the gradual growth can be anticipated as consumers in the region have become more accepting to use dishwashers as part of a modern lifestyle.
Competitive Analysis
The key players in the global dishwasher market are Whirlpool Corporation, LG Electronics, Electrolux AB, Robert Bosch GmbH, Haier Group, Samsung Electronics Co. Ltd., Panasonic Corporation, Voltas, Godrej, and The Miele Company, among others.
In September 2024, Samsung launched Bespoke Dishware at the IFA 2024 Expo in Germany. Samsung claims that this dishwasher is 10% more power efficient than required for the Class A power efficiency rating.
In February 2024, LG launched a 14-person dishwasher called LG Dios Objet Collection Dishwasher. These dishwashers are available in built-in as well as freestanding types.
